Kara Whelply is an Associate Director, MI Philanthropy. She works on the Center’s biomedical research team, where she advises individual philanthropists on therapeutic development with methods to identify, fund, and accelerate treatments. Her current portfolio includes advancing the therapeutic development of treatments for bipolar disorder and follicular lymphoma. Prior to joining the Milken Institute, Whelply was an ORISE fellow at the Center for Drug Evaluation and Research at the US Food and Drug Administration where she focused on regulatory data and knowledge management systems to improve efficiency and workflow for regulatory reviewers and administrators. Whelply received both a Master of Business Administration and a Master of Public Health with a concentration in epidemiology from the University of Alabama at Birmingham and has a bachelor’s degree from the University of Alabama. She is based in the Institute’s Washington, DC office.
